💡 What: Extracted expensive string concatenation,
toLowerCase()conversions, andDateobject instantiations from the high-frequencyrenderPDFsfilter loop andcreatePDFCardloop. These are now pre-calculated once during initial load viaprepareSearchIndex. The filter logic was also refactored to use early returns.🎯 Why: Instantiating Date objects, formatting strings with
toLocaleDateString, and allocating new concatenated search strings inline during every single filter and render iteration causes significant main-thread slowdowns, especially as the size ofpdfDatabasegrows.📊 Impact: Reduces time spent filtering and formatting by ~165x (From ~550ms to ~3.3ms over 100 iterations for 5k records in V8 benchmark). Decreases lag when typing in the search bar.
🔬 Measurement: Verified the search filtering logic still accurately matches fields via a custom Playwright frontend test mocking the Firestore database. Benchmark script was used to measure local performance gains.
